[flang-commits] [flang] [Flang][OpenMP] Add Semantics support for Nested OpenMPLoopConstructs (PR #145917)
via flang-commits
flang-commits at lists.llvm.org
Sun Jul 6 06:41:13 PDT 2025
ronlieb wrote:
seeing random 5 out of 30 compilations fail
"flang" "-fc1" "-triple" "x86_64-unknown-linux-gnu" "-emit-llvm-bc" "-mrelocation-model" "static" "-ffast-math" "-target-cpu" "x86-64" "-floop-interchange" "-vectorize-loops" "-vectorize-slp" "-fversion-loops-for-stride" "-fopenmp" "-fopenmp-targets=amdgcn-amd-amdhsa" "-mframe-pointer=none" "-O3" "-x" "f95" "update_halo_kernel-gfx90a-8cde79"
#4 0x000014937e341abe Fortran::semantics::CanonicalizationOfOmp::RewriteOpenMPLoopConstruct(Fortran::parser::OpenMPLoopConstruct&, std
::__cxx11::list<Fortran::parser::ExecutionPartConstruct, std::allocator<Fortran::parser::ExecutionPartConstruct>>&, std::_List_iterator
<Fortran::parser::ExecutionPartConstruct>) (/mnt/COD/2025-07-06/trunk_21.0-0/bin/../lib/../lib/libFortranSemantics.so.21.0git+0x1a8abe)
#5 0x000014937e342040 Fortran::semantics::CanonicalizationOfOmp::Post(std::__cxx11::list<Fortran::parser::ExecutionPartConstruct, std:
:allocator<Fortran::parser::ExecutionPartConstruct>>&) (/mnt/COD/2025-07-06/trunk_21.0-0/bin/../lib/../lib/libFortranSemantics.so.21.0g
it+0x1a9040)
#6 0x000014937e35151d void Fortran::parser::detail::ParseTreeVisitorLookupScope::Walk<Fortran::semantics::CanonicalizationOfOmp>(std::
__cxx11::list<Fortran::parser::ExecutionPartConstruct, std::allocator<Fortran::parser::ExecutionPartConstruct>>&, Fortran::semantics::C
anonicalizationOfOmp&) (/mnt/COD/2025-07-06/trunk_21.0-0/bin/../lib/../lib/libFortranSemantics.so.21.0git+0x1b851d)
#7 0x000014937e35151d void Fortran::parser::detail::ParseTreeVisitorLookupScope::Walk<Fortran::semantics::CanonicalizationOfOmp>(std::
__cxx11::list<Fortran::parser::ExecutionPartConstruct, std::allocator<Fortran::parser::ExecutionPartConstruct>>&, Fortran::semantics::C
anonicalizationOfOmp&) (/mnt/COD/2025-07-06/trunk_21.0-0/bin/../lib/../lib/libFortranSemantics.so.21.0git+0x1b851d)
https://github.com/llvm/llvm-project/pull/145917
More information about the flang-commits
mailing list